About C Döhring

C Döhring is a scholar working on Immunology, Oncology, Molecular Biology, Surgery and Neurology, having authored 13 papers that have together received 964 indexed citations. Recurring topics across this work include T-cell and B-cell Immunology (8 papers), Immune Cell Function and Interaction (7 papers), Immunotherapy and Immune Responses (4 papers), CAR-T cell therapy research (3 papers), Chemokine receptors and signaling (2 papers), Galectins and Cancer Biology (1 paper), Cardiovascular Health and Disease Prevention (1 paper) and Intracranial Aneurysms: Treatment and Complications (1 paper). The work is most often cited by research in Immunology (859 citations), Oncology (123 citations), Hematology (51 citations), Immunology and Allergy (13 citations) and Transplantation (4 citations). C Döhring has collaborated with scholars based in Switzerland, United States and Croatia. Frequent co-authors include Marco Colonna, Jacqueline Samaridis, Marina Cella, Doris Scheidegger, Mark C. Dessing, Manfred Brockhaus, Antonio Lanzavecchia, Lena Ångman, Giulio C. Spagnoli and G Burg. Their work appears in journals such as Immunogenetics, Critical Reviews in Immunology, The Journal of Immunology, European Journal of Immunology and International Journal of Cancer.
